The Rheinauhafen in Cologne is a stunning example of urban regeneration, transforming a once-bustling industrial harbor into a vibrant waterfront district. Characterized by its modern architecture, including the iconic Kranhäuser (Crane Houses), the Rheinauhafen offers a blend of residential, commercial, and cultural spaces. Visitors can explore museums like the Chocolate Museum and the German Sport & Olympia Museum, stroll along the Rhine promenade, and enjoy diverse culinary experiences. The area seamlessly blends historical elements with contemporary design, creating a unique atmosphere that attracts locals and tourists alike. Its central location and excellent transport links make it easily accessible, establishing it as a must-see destination in Cologne. The Rheinauhafen is more than just a visual spectacle; it's a testament to Cologne's innovative spirit and its ability to reinvent itself while preserving its rich history.

Public Transport
To reach Rheinauhafen via public transport, take tram lines 15 or 16 to the Ubierring stop. From there, it's a short walk towards the Rhine. Alternatively, bus line 133 stops at Rheinauhafen and Schokoladenmuseum. A single ticket (Preisstufe 1b) costs approximately €2.80.
Walking
From Cologne's city center (e.g., the Cologne Cathedral), walk south along the Rhine promenade. The walk is approximately 2 km and takes about 25-30 minutes, offering scenic views along the way. Follow the Rhine River, passing the Hohenzollern Bridge, until you reach the modern architecture of Rheinauhafen.
Taxi/Ride-Share
A taxi or ride-share from Cologne's city center to Rheinauhafen typically costs between €10-€15, depending on traffic. The journey takes approximately 5-10 minutes. Use 'Rheinauhafen' as your destination.
Driving
If driving, enter 'Rheinauhafen 50678 Köln' into your navigation system. Public parking is available in the 'Parkhaus Rheinauhafen/Harry-Blum-Platz 2'. Parking costs approximately €3.50 per hour, with a daily maximum of €45. Evening parking (20:00-07:00) costs around €30.
